On Thu, Apr 24, 2025 at 01:18:35PM +0100, Matthew Auld wrote:
> We now use the same notifier lock for SVM and userptr, with that we can
> combine xe_pt_userptr_pre_commit and xe_pt_svm_pre_commit.
>
> v2: (Matt B)
> - Re-use xe_svm_notifier_lock/unlock for userptr.
> - Combine svm/userptr handling further down into op_check_svm_userptr.
>
> Suggested-by: Matthew Brost <matthew.brost@intel.com>
The Kconfig issues pointed out in the previous patch need to be fixed
but implementation here look correct:
Reviewed-by: Matthew Brost <matthew.brost@intel.com>
